Chanderi
Chanderi is a village located in Simga tehsil of Raipur district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Simga (tehsildar office) and 53km away from district headquarter Raipur. As per 2009 stats, Chanderi village is also a gram panchayat.

About Chanderi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chanderi is 443506. The village spans a total geographical area of 475.5 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 493101. Simga is nearest town to Chanderi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Population of Chanderi
Below is a concise population overview of Chanderi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,474 | 743 | 731 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 283 | 146 | 137 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 383 | 192 | 191 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 65 | 28 | 37 |
Literate Population | 869 | 491 | 378 |
Illiterate Population | 605 | 252 | 353 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Chanderi village:
- The total population of Chanderi village is around 1,474, including approximately 743 males and 731 females, with a sex ratio of 983 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 283 children aged 0–6 years in Chanderi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Chanderi village has 383 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 65 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Chanderi village is about 58.96%, with male literacy at 66.08% and female literacy at 51.71%.
- There are around 284 households in Chanderi village.
Connectivity of Chanderi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chanderi. As per the 2011 stats, Chanderi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
